Blood transcriptomes and de novo identification of candidate loci for mating success in lekking great snipe (Gallinago media).

Abstract excerpt
We assembled the great snipe blood transcriptome using data from fourteen lekking males, in order to de novo identify candidate genes related to sexual selection, and determined the expression profiles in relation to mating success.
